Ravens' Earl Thomas victim of burglary, intent to assault



Ravens safety Earl Thomas was the victim of burglary and intent to commit aggravated assault during an April 13 incident, according to an Austin, Texas police report obtained by NFL Media.According to the police report, three women, including Earl's wife, Nina, were arrested on charges of burglary of a residence after Austin police responded to a call at 3:40 a.m. on April 13. Nina, listed in the police report as Nina Teresa Baham-Heisser, was also charged with burglary of a residence with intent to commit aggravated assault with a deadly weapon.Thomas and his brother, Seth, were identified as victims.
